Hiroshima mon Amour the fragrance sort of re-creates the French and Japanese conversation of the movie in olfactive form. It has a contrasting kind of construction and feels like the give and take of a lively debate. I found it to be really interesting due to the nature of this fragrant conversation taking place on my skin.
